Technical Analysis

From a technical perspective, UEC has been trading in a relatively tight range in recent weeks, between a support level of $14.12 and resistance at $15.60. The stock’s current price of $14.86 places it near the midpoint of that range, consistent with the lack of strong directional momentum in recent sessions. The relative strength index (RSI) for UEC is currently in the mid-40s, indicating a neutral technical position with no signals of overbought or oversold conditions at present. The stock is also trading near the middle of its short-term moving average range, with no clear bullish or bearish crossover signals observed as of today. The $14.12 support level has been tested three times in recent weeks, with consistent buying interest emerging each time the stock approaches that price point, establishing it as a reliable near-term floor. The $15.60 resistance level has been tested twice in the same period, with selling pressure pushing the stock lower each time it nears that threshold, confirming its role as a near-term ceiling for price action. Outlook

Looking ahead, there are two key technical scenarios that market participants are monitoring for UEC. If the stock is able to sustain a move above the $15.60 resistance level on above-average volume, it could potentially test higher trading ranges in subsequent sessions, per technical analysts’ observations. Conversely, if UEC breaks below the $14.12 support level, that could trigger further near-term selling pressure, as stop-loss orders positioned near that support level may be activated. Both scenarios are highly contingent on broader uranium sector sentiment, as well as macroeconomic factors that impact commodity markets more broadly, including interest rate expectations and global energy policy announcements. While long-term market expectations for uranium demand remain relatively positive as countries expand low-carbon energy infrastructure, near-term price action for Uranium Energy Corp will likely continue to be dictated by the established support and resistance levels, as well as short-term trading flows in the sector.
